Is it important to look at yield in Ainthorpe in further detail?

As you may be aware, rental yield is an extremely important metric to judge how effective a property is in terms of producing a return on investment. In the city of Ainthorpe, there is an average of no relevant data for this city for rental yield.
Ainthorpe can be compared to the rest of the UK that tends to have an average of around 4.4% yield where the higher the yield the higher the return on the amount of money in the deal. This is because the area’s rental yield of no relevant data for this city is first worked out by multiplying the monthly rent by twelve to find the annual rent. Then, you take away the associated costs of the property from the annual rental income to find the net rent. This net rent can then be divided by the purchase price and multiplied by 100 to find the rental yield as a percentage.

In the area, using Rightmove data, what are most people selling their property for?

The average sold price of properties in Ainthorpe, UK, available on Rightmove is £211,677. See the below table to work out what the sold price is based on detached housing, semi-detached housing, terraced housing and flats.

Category of property Average price
Flat £145,061
Terraced house £184,859
Semi-detached house £207,453
detached house £311,990
